It is that time of the year. Students are anxious of their results and parents are worried how their kid will fare.

The board exam results will be out soon, and the perpetual question ‘kitne aaye?’ will be all over the place. The struggle to get into the best college will overpower the sanity of many people.

However, one thing that we really need to ask is how much do these marks really matter? Does our performance in Boards decide how well we do in life? Does our marksheets guarantee happiness and contentment in life?

Hear these famous comedians out and decide for yourself.

Vir Das on What Really Matters

Your marks don’t matter. Your results don’t matter. The only thing that matters is the voice inside your head. Listen to it.
